Shedding Issues

gopherlover Aug 18, 2003 01:37 PM

My sd gopher started the shedding rutine about 9 days ago. He got blue eyed for about 5 days and then they cleared up and that is the point he is at now. He has been that way for about 4 days. Is this normal? LAst time he shedded it all happened in a matter of 5 days not close to ten. Should i soak his in a bucket of warm water? I have even heard that warm tea works just as well. Is this true?

Dana K Aug 19, 2003 02:24 PM

My adult SD usually takes 10 days from the first hint of hazy eyes. Last time it took 12 days. I assume you give yours a soaking dish or humid hide during this?
